ASSIGNMENT DETAILS

Position Title: Assistant Cheer Coach - Sr. High

Season: Fall & Winter

Brainerd Public Schools, where opportunity meets excellence!

We are dedicated to fostering a dynamic and inclusive work environment that values diversity, innovation, and collaboration. As an integral part of our community, we strive to empower educators, administrators, and staff to make a positive impact on the lives of our students. Our team is passionate about shaping the future of education in the Brainerd Lakes Area.

POSITION SUMMARY

The Assistant Coach provides leadership and expertise regarding the rules, strategies, and techniques for the assigned activity, utilizing knowledge of the specific equipment, physical fitness and safety to prepare participants mentally and physically to compete at the highest level.

ESSENTIAL FUNCTIONS
  • Facilitates successful practices and attends meets.
  • Provide leadership and guidance to staff in support of the Head Coach.
  • Encourage student participation and establish rapport.
  • Motivate participants/athletes to achieve maximum potential.
  • Work collaboratively with Head Coach, Activities Director, families and community resources.
  • Maintains compliance with all rules and regulations.
  • Complies with and supports all school district regulations and policies.
  • Other duties as determined by the Head Coach.
